Day: January 17, 2014

$17 Trillion and Counting

Congress is beginning 2014  with a bipartisan budget deal that busts right through “caps” it was supposed to have on spending. To understand the amount of debt [$17 trillion]  we’re already under, we need to put it into perspective. One…

Firearms Deter Crime

Detroit Police Chief James Craig was interviewed by Steve Malzberg about the reduced crime rate in Detroit in 2013. Chief Craig attributes that, in part, to the fact that many Detroit citizens carry concealed weapons.